Toyota GT86 gets 325bhp from Gazoo Racing – again

Thu, 03 Jan 2013

Toyota’s renegade Gazoo Racing are teasing another Toyota GT86 with 325bhp – the GRMN FR Sports Concept Platinum – for the Tokyo Auto Salon. There’s been a lot of speculation surrounding the Toyoya GT 86 (and the Subarua BRZ too) and the likelihood that it will get forced induction at some point to offer a chunk more power than its standard 197bhp. It’s always seemed likely that Toyota and Subaru would add a supercharger or turbo (or both) to their cars to give a properly powerful option.

50 Years of Bond Cars at the National Motor Museum

Mon, 24 Oct 2011

Release the oil slick, raise the bulletproof rear screen and push the red ejector seat button in anticipation of what promises to be one of the must-see automotive attractions of 2012: Bond in Motion. Tell me more, Moneypenny 2012 will mark the 50th anniversary of Sean Connery's first utterance of the icnonic 'the name's Bond, James Bond' line, and to celebrate this celluloid milestone the National Motor Museum at Beaulieu is hosting Bond in Motion, an exciting exhibition of the fictional spy's 50 most recognisable vehicles. The year-long display of 007's cars, motorbikes, boats and other unlikely forms of transportation promises to be the largest of its kind anywhere in the world.

Penske's plan for Saturn: Sell Samsung vehicles

Tue, 26 May 2009

Entrepreneur Roger Penske wants to use the Saturn dealership network to sell vehicles built by Renault Samsung Motors and imported from South Korea. According to Automotive News, Penske recently met with Renault and Nissan CEO Carlos Ghosn in Paris to talk about the plan. Renault owns 80.1 percent of Renault Samsung.
